So, my question is... My Droid has paired with my JCW just fine. I can scroll through all my contacts using the other knob. But, when using the voice commands, I am told that the phone book is empty.
How can I download the phone book to the car?
Note: My wife's X3 has exactly the same problem with her Blackberry 8830.

For a while we thought the "empty phone book" message came from particular phones, but we've since figured out that cars without the factory installed nav need voice tags recorded to use voice dialing.
If you haven't recorded any voice tags to match with a phone book entry, this is the message that gets played. Cars that do have the nav system don't need the voice tags recorded to do the matching.

Voice tags partly depend on what options you have in the car.
If you have NAV then the bluetooth should (but will not always) search the phones phone book and make the call from that.
If you do not have NAV then you will have to set up the voice tags in the MINI itself and that can be confusing as some manuals had misprints that made the system fail.
Also of note is that some phones work better than others in the cars. Please also be aware that the phone firmware (software) also make a difference in some cases.
